Pakistan spin-bowling all-rounder Imad Wasim said he would put Babar Azam ahead of India batting superstar Virat Kohli.

Kohli and Azam have constantly been compared to each other, with many former and current cricketers being asked which one they think is better.

In this case, Imad opted for Azam, calling him the pride of Pakistan.

“I would go Babar Azam. He’s our nation’s pride. We can criticise him, we can say things about him in a right way that he becomes [an] amazing player. But, he has served Pakistan with dignity and pride for a long time. He’s our pride,” he was quoted as saying by Cricket Pakistan.

Azam recently represented Pakistan in their three-match Test series against Australia and mustered 126 runs at an average of 21.

He then proceeded to make 213 runs, which included three fifties, at an average of 42.60 and a strike-rate of 142 in the five-match T20I series against New Zealand.

The 29-year-old is now captaining the Peshawar Zalmi in the 2024 Pakistan Super League (PSL) and has made scores of 68, 72 and 31 in his first three matches against the Quetta Gladiators, Karachi Kings and Multan Sultans respectively.
